**Handover — Data-Centre Cage Visit (Hollis to incoming starter)**

Welcome aboard. Our cage is Row 7 at the Dunmere facility. Book visits at least 24 hours ahead through the portal, bring photo ID, and expect a bag check at the loading entrance. Inside, photography is prohibited and tools must be logged in and out with the duty technician. The cage itself has a keypad on the inner gate; the current code is:

badge for hahip-bagag: bdg-FIJ-9

Ticket PM-armature: stale-cache bug postmortem. Summary: the Fernwheel plugin cache served expired manifests for six hours after the TTL change. Plugin authors should verify their manifests now bust correctly on version bump; details in the attached timeline. Remediation items are complete. This postmortem requires sign-off from the responsible engineer named below.

account owner for bawif-yawip: Ralmir Wenmir

Ticket: DEDUP-412 — Connection failures during customer record dedup

The Larkspur dedup job started failing overnight with pool exhaustion errors. It merges duplicate customer records in batches of 500, but the batch worker isn't releasing connections after a merge conflict, so the pool drains within twenty minutes. Proposed fix: wrap merges in a try/finally release and cap retries at three. For the sync, reproduce against staging using the connection string below.

primary connection of bagep-kaweg = clickhouse://rusdor_svc:3TXlgH7O8DuUYI@db-ae3f.zarqelgrid.internal:5432/zordor

Step 4: Confirm parity between the Lumetra Swift SDK and the Kotlin SDK before promoting. Both must pass the shared conformance suite on the Brell staging cluster. The suite pulls fixtures from our private registry, which requires a token. In the runner's env file, add the line below.

env line for baguf-fajop: VAULT_KEY29=55a9f564d54882bbe7acf5741bf1a

14:22 — Offline sync regression confirmed (Terrapath field-survey app)

At 14:22 the on-call engineer reproduced the data-loss path: surveys saved while offline were marked synced once connectivity returned, even when the upload was rejected. The queue flush skipped the server acknowledgement check introduced in the previous sprint. Release manager note: the fix must ship before the coastal survey season. The offending build is identified by the token recorded below.

session token of kawif-fawig = htk31_f3f599be2b1a34affb1efa8d0feccf8